How they compare

South Africa currently reports 251,724 one-year-olds against 242,358 one-year-olds in Chad, a difference of 9,366 one-year-olds.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 16 shared years of data; in 2008 it was Chad ahead.

Chad ranks 20th and South Africa ranks 19th of 191 countries.

Chad has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Chad South Africa Difference Ahead
2000s 394,151 one-year-olds 241,973 one-year-olds 152,178 one-year-olds Chad
2010s 345,450 one-year-olds 230,192 one-year-olds 115,258 one-year-olds Chad
2020s 262,024 one-year-olds 195,522 one-year-olds 66,502 one-year-olds Chad

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
